 I have used Fairy Lili, if there was ever an image that made me think of Inky Impressions this is the one, I think she is gorgeous and so adaptable too. The sentiment is also from Inky Impressions. I coloured her with copics and added glamour dust to her wings. I added some felt ribbon, and some dotty satin ribbon and the ruffled ribbon too, phew lol. Pretty blooms and some pearls.
